Поделиться через


MessageFactory.ContentUrl Метод

Определение

Возвращает действие сообщения, содержащее одно изображение или видео.

public static Microsoft.Bot.Schema.IMessageActivity ContentUrl (string url, string contentType, string name = default, string text = default, string ssml = default, string inputHint = default);
static member ContentUrl : string * string * string * string * string * string -> Microsoft.Bot.Schema.IMessageActivity
Public Shared Function ContentUrl (url As String, contentType As String, Optional name As String = Nothing, Optional text As String = Nothing, Optional ssml As String = Nothing, Optional inputHint As String = Nothing) As IMessageActivity

Параметры

url
String

URL-адрес изображения или видео для отправки.

contentType
String

Тип MIME изображения или видео.

name
String

Необязательное имя изображения или видеофайла.

text
String

Текст отправляемого сообщения (необязательно).

ssml
String

Необязательный текст, который будет произносить бот в канале с поддержкой речи (необязательно).

inputHint
String

Необязательно. Указывает, принимает ли бот, ожидает или игнорирует введенные пользователем данные после доставки сообщения клиенту. Один из следующих вариантов: acceptingInput, ignoringInput или expectingInput. Значением по умолчанию является NULL.

Возвращаемое значение

Действие сообщения, содержащее вложение.

Исключения

url или contentType имеет значение null, пустое или пробел.

Примеры

Этот код создает действие сообщения, содержащее изображение.

IMessageActivity message =
    MessageFactory.ContentUrl("https://{domainName}/cat.jpg", MediaTypeNames.Image.Jpeg, "Cat Picture");

Применяется к